Sanibel Captiva Handbook on Kindle

Extra, Extra..... Read all about it!


You may remember when I did a post a few weeks ago about the newly released 2014 edition of the Sanibel Captiva Handbook.   Well, I have more exciting news!  The handbook is now available in it's full edition, on Kindle.  The Kindle version is exactly the same as the physical book, including the photos. 

The easy-to-carry soft cover edition is available on their website for $ 13.95 plus taxes and shipping.  And if you're so excited to get your copy that you simply can't wait, then head over to Amazon and order the instantly down-loadable version for $ 9.95.  Either way - it's a great book with current information on the islands as well as maps, directions, pictures, history and so much more.  The best part about the Kindle version is that you can easily carry your handbook with you all the time!!
